Integrating Holistic Community Support Models

Education does not happen in a vacuum. You must recognize that a student's ability to learn depends heavily on their home environment. You should integrate family support mechanisms directly into your child sponsorship programs. When households face extreme financial instability, children often leave school to work. You can prevent this by offering microfinance opportunities to parents and caregivers. These small loans empower families to build sustainable income streams. A stable household income directly correlates with higher student retention rates. You must treat the entire family unit as a partner in the educational process.

Your operational strategy must address the specific cultural and economic realities of the regions you serve. You should partner with local community leaders to design culturally sensitive intervention programs. These partnerships ensure your initiatives align with the actual needs of the population. You can implement mentorship programs to guide students through their academic journeys. Mentors provide necessary emotional support and academic guidance. This additional layer of support significantly improves long-term educational outcomes. You build stronger communities when you respect local knowledge and traditions.

Measuring Tangible Educational Outcomes

You cannot improve what you do not measure. You must establish strict evaluation criteria for all your educational initiatives. You should track quantitative metrics like school attendance, graduation rates, and standardized test scores. These numbers provide a baseline understanding of your program's effectiveness. You must also gather qualitative data regarding student well-being and community engagement. This combination of data types allows you to present a highly accurate picture of your impact. You can use this data to refine your operational strategies continuously. Objective measurement prevents resource allocation based purely on assumptions.

Your evaluation process must remain objective and highly rigorous. You should employ independent auditors to review your impact metrics periodically. This external validation adds significant credibility to your reporting efforts. You must identify specific areas where students continue to struggle despite your interventions. When you acknowledge these challenges, you can allocate resources more effectively to solve them. You can partner with local educational authorities to ensure your metrics align with regional standards. You build a stronger operational framework when you invite external scrutiny.

You should focus your measurement efforts on specific key performance indicators to ensure accurate reporting. You must define these metrics clearly before you launch any new educational initiative. This preparation allows you to track progress consistently from day one.

  • Track the year-over-year improvement in student literacy and numeracy rates across all participating schools.
  • Measure the percentage of sponsored students who successfully transition to higher education or vocational training.
  • Evaluate the retention rates of students within your program over a five-year period to assess long-term stability.
  • Assess the impact of supplementary mentorship programs on overall student academic performance and behavioral development.

Strengthening Operational Governance

Strong internal governance forms the backbone of any sustainable non-profit organization. You must establish clear policies regarding the management and distribution of all collected funds. You should implement strict oversight mechanisms to prevent any misuse of resources. When you maintain impeccable operational standards, you protect your organization from reputational damage. You can attract highly skilled professionals to your board of directors by demonstrating strong governance. These individuals bring valuable expertise that can further optimize your operations. You must view governance as an asset rather than an administrative burden.

You must document every standard operating procedure within your organization. You should create comprehensive manuals detailing how staff should handle donor data and beneficiary information. This documentation ensures operational continuity even when key personnel leave the organization. You must prioritize data security to protect the privacy of both your donors and your students. You can utilize encrypted database systems to manage all sensitive information safely. A secure operation builds confidence among all your stakeholders. You reduce organizational risk when you standardize your internal processes.

You should implement specific governance practices to ensure long-term operational stability and regulatory compliance. You must train your executive team to enforce these policies consistently. This rigorous oversight protects your organization from internal mismanagement.

  • Establish an independent advisory board to review all major financial decisions and program expansions objectively.
  • Conduct comprehensive background checks on all staff members and volunteers interacting directly with vulnerable beneficiaries.
  • Develop strict conflict of interest policies for all board members and executive leadership to maintain absolute integrity.
  • Create a transparent grievance mechanism for local communities to report any operational concerns without fear of retaliation.
